luigi@ace.com (Luigi) writes:
<Is there any good comm program for the Apple II(gs) that works at up to
<14400 baud and has good COLOR ANSI?
<I already have Proterm and Gterm and have tried several others...
<Proterm is really fast but the ANSI sucks and it's not color.
<Gterm is really -slow- but the ANSI is really good. (Gterm loses
<characters at any faster than 2400 baud :( )
<Is there anything inbetween the two??? I'd like a minumum baud
<capability of 9600 that almost never loses characters and has ANSI like
<Gterm's... Does this yet exist? If not, get busy :)
try ANSIterm from PMP Products (pmp@delphi.com) I tossed ProTERM within a week of m
betting ANSIterm - golor ANSI, faster downloads (about 10%), doesn't lose
charactes at 14.4/57.6 (8MHZ ROM 1 GS), and the list price si signficantly lower.
Oh - it also has a Macro Language that is at least as good as that hin ProTERM)
